Tempest Announces Interim Results from Ongoing REDEEM-1 Trial of TPST-2003, Preparing for Potential U.S. Registrational Study in 2026
Globenewswire· 2026-02-25 12:59
Core Insights - Tempest Therapeutics announced promising clinical data from the ongoing REDEEM-1 Phase 1/2a trial for TPST-2003, a dual-targeting CAR-T therapy for relapsed/refractory multiple myeloma [1][6] Clinical Data Summary - TPST-2003 is designed to enhance response depth and durability in patients with relapsed/refractory multiple myeloma through a dual-targeting CAR structure [2] - As of January 31, 2026, 36 patients with relapsed/refractory multiple myeloma have received TPST-2003, with a median of four prior lines of therapy [3] - All six evaluable patients in the REDEEM-1 trial achieved a complete response (CR), resulting in an overall response rate (ORR) of 100% among 25 evaluable patients [4][8] Safety Profile - TPST-2003 demonstrated a favorable safety profile across all dose levels, with no Grade >3 cytokine release syndrome (CRS) or immune effector cell-associated neurotoxicity syndrome (ICANS) reported [7][9] - The prior investigator-initiated trial (IIT) showed a median progression-free survival (PFS) of 23.1 months, including patients with extramedullary disease [8][10] Future Development Plans - Tempest plans to accelerate the development of TPST-2003 and intends to submit a U.S. IND application, aiming to initiate a U.S. registrational study in 2026 [6][15] - The company is also exploring the potential of TPST-2003 for treating large B-cell lymphoma and other related indications [6][12] Treatment Landscape - Approved CAR-T therapies have shown clinical benefits in relapsed/refractory multiple myeloma, but challenges such as relapse and toxicity management remain prevalent [13] - TPST-2003's dual-targeting CAR structure aims to address tumor heterogeneity and antigen escape, which are significant factors in disease progression [14]
Tempest Lays Out Strategic Plan to Advance Recently Acquired Dual-Targeting CAR-T Assets
Globenewswire· 2026-02-11 11:59
Core Insights - Tempest Therapeutics, Inc. is advancing its CAR-T assets post-transaction while maintaining a capital-efficient operational model [1][6] Strategic Priorities - The company will prioritize the development of its dual-targeting CD19/BCMA CAR-T program, TPST-2003, with clinical data expected from an ongoing Phase 1 trial in China and a registrational Phase 2b trial anticipated to start by the end of 2026 [2][3] - TPST-4003, an in vivo CAR-T program, aims to deliver the same dual-targeting construct without ex vivo cell manufacturing, with plans for preclinical development and potential clinical entry through a partner-funded trial [4][6] - Amezalpat is positioned for pivotal development in first-line h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), with plans for business development discussions to advance this program [4] - The company plans to initiate a Phase 2 study of TPST-1495 in familial adenomatous polyposis (FAP), with first patient enrollment expected in Q1 2026, funded by the National Cancer Institute [5][6] Pipeline Expansion - Tempest is expanding its next-generation CAR-T pipeline, which includes additional dual-targeting CAR-T programs such as TPST-3003, TPST-2206, and TPST-3206 [6][7]

Tempest Announces Strategic Acquisition of New Dual-CAR T Programs from Factor with Simultaneous Runway Extension Projected to Mid 2027
Globenewswire· 2025-11-19 14:00
Core Viewpoint - Tempest Therapeutics, Inc. has announced an all-stock acquisition of dual-targeting CAR-T programs from Factor Bioscience, aimed at expanding its clinical pipeline and extending its operational runway to mid-2027 [1][2][4] Group 1: Acquisition Details - The acquisition includes the first clinical-stage CD19/BCMA dual-CAR T program, TPST-2003, designed for patients with extramedullary disease [2][3] - Tempest will issue 8,268,495 shares of common stock to Factor, representing 65% of the outstanding shares post-transaction [9] - The transaction is expected to close in early 2026, pending stockholder approval and other customary conditions [12] Group 2: Pipeline Expansion - The acquisition will diversify Tempest's pipeline, which includes amezalpat (Phase 3-ready) and TPST-1495 (Phase 2 expected to start soon) [3][4] - TPST-2003 has completed Phase 1 trials in patients with relapsed multiple myeloma, with data expected in 2026 and a biologics license application planned for 2027 in China [4] - Tempest plans to continue developing additional preclinical and research-stage programs, including TPST-2206 and TPST-3003 [4] Group 3: Financial and Operational Outlook - Existing cash and an investment commitment from Factor are expected to support operations through mid-2027, including key development milestones [2][9] - The company plans to pursue business development discussions or additional financing to advance the pivotal development of amezalpat in first-line liver cancer [4] - The anticipated preclosing equity financing is expected to extend Tempest's runway and support significant milestones [3][4] Group 4: Leadership Changes - Upon closing, Matt Angel, Ph.D., will become the President and CEO, while Stephen Brady will transition to Chairman of the board [3][9] - Dr. Angel has extensive experience in biotechnology and cell therapy, having previously led Factor Bioscience and other cell therapy companies [8][10]
Tempest Therapeutics(TPST) - 2025 Q3 - Quarterly Report
2025-11-05 14:12
Financial Position - As of September 30, 2025, the company had cash and cash equivalents totaling $7.5 million, down from $30.3 million as of December 31, 2024[96]. - The accumulated deficit as of September 30, 2025, is $229.3 million, indicating ongoing financial challenges[96]. - As of September 30, 2025, the company had $3.5 million in material cash requirements payable within 12 months, including $1.1 million related to the Brisbane Lease[136]. - The primary use of cash is to fund operating expenses, primarily research and development expenditures, headcount costs, and lease expenses[135]. - The company has no long-term debt and no material non-cancelable purchase commitments with service providers[137]. - The company is classified as a "smaller reporting company," with a market value of shares held by non-affiliates less than $700 million[140]. Research and Development - Research and development expenses for Q3 2025 were $570,000, a decrease of 92% compared to $7.6 million in Q3 2024[108]. - Total research and development expenses for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, were $12.1 million, a decrease of $5.6 million (32%) from $17.7 million in the same period in 2024[114]. - Amezalpat research costs for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, were $5.3 million, down 24% from $7.0 million in 2024[116]. - Research and development expenses decreased by $7.0 million to $0.6 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$7.6 million for the same period in 2024, primarily due to re-prioritizing efforts towards exploring strategic alternatives[110]. Clinical Trials and Designations - Amezalpat is set to begin a pivotal Phase 3 study in first-line h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), with positive feedback received from the FDA on the trial design[90]. - The FDA granted Orphan Drug Designation for amezalpat in January 2025, and Fast Track Designation in February 2025, which may provide regulatory advantages[91][92]. - TPST-1495 is expected to enter a Phase 2 study in patients with Familial Adenomatous Polyposis (FAP) in late 2025, pending potential delays due to the U.S. government shutdown[94]. Expenses and Losses - General and administrative expenses for Q3 2025 were $3.0 million, a slight increase of 1% from $2.99 million in Q3 2024[108]. - The net loss for Q3 2025 was $3.5 million, a reduction of 67% compared to a net loss of $10.6 million in Q3 2024[108]. - General and administrative expenses remained stable at $3.0 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to the same period in 2024[112]. - Interest expense related to the Oxford Loan was eliminated in the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$329 thousand in the same period in 2024[113]. - Cash used in operating activities for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$23.2 million, compared to $22.9 million in 2024[128]. - Cash used in operating activities for the nine months ended September 30, 2024, was $22.9 million, with a net loss of $28.0 million[130]. Financing Activities - The company repaid the Oxford Loan in full in April 2025, which had a total outstanding amount of $3.5 million[123]. - The company sold 312,830 shares of common stock for proceeds of $2.8 million under the ATM Program as of September 30, 2025[125]. - The net proceeds from a registered direct offering on June 11, 2025, were approximately $4.1 million after deducting fees and expenses[127]. - Cash provided by financing activities for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, included net proceeds from a registered direct offering of $4.1 million[133]. - Cash provided by financing activities for the nine months ended September 30, 2024, included proceeds from the issuance of common stock totaling $8.8 million[134]. Stock and Corporate Actions - A one-for-thirteen reverse stock split was executed on April 8, 2025, adjusting the number of shares and options accordingly[101]. - There have been no significant changes to critical accounting policies since December 31, 2024[138].
